Simpson Thacher Partners Author Article on the GENIUS Act’s Regulatory Framework for Stablecoins

08.14.25

Partners Brian Christiansen, Spencer Sloan and Amanda Allexon, and Associate James Fine, authored an article titled, “GENIUS Act Establishes Regulatory Framework for Stablecoins,” which was published by Thomson Reuters Westlaw. The article discussed the Guiding and Establishing National Innovation for U.S. Stablecoins (GENIUS) Act, which was recently signed into law and establishes a regulatory framework for the issuance of stablecoins backed by U.S. dollars, short-term U.S. Treasuries and certain other enumerated assets. The article detailed key provisions of the Act, including its use of the term “payment stablecoin,” reserve and custody requirements for payment stablecoins, permitted payment stablecoin issuers (PPSIs), the federal regulatory framework for PPSIs, examination and enforcement provisions, alternative state-based framework and effective date and implementation, as well as digital asset and banking industry reactions.
